Clear coat is already on the car, and I doubt very seriously, the dealer takes new cars into the body shop, sands 'em, and sprays more on.

Looking at that web site, It appears to be a wax/polymer paint sealant.

Read "Dealer profit item". You don't need, and can do better yourself with something like Zaino or others.

Glass etching is actually not a bad idea. By etching the glass a potential thief will have to replace all the glass to get rid of it... not cheap...

The glass is etched at the dealer. Got mine done for "free".
